Animals that live in the Sahara desert

The Sahara is one of the largest deserts in the world.It is located in North Africa, and some of its sand dunes can reach almost two hundred meters high.from a dry and dry desert, where you can find some oases around which certain types of animal and plant life develop.Among the surviving animals we can mention:

Adax (Addax nasomaculatus)

Although formerly the Sahara was one of its habitats, today the adax is in critical danger of extinction, so there is only a small population in countries like Nigeria and Chad.

En a kind of antilope that has diminished by indiscriminate hunting.In its old distribution, the adax adapted perfectly to Saharan conditions.It is capable of living with few amounts of water, because it rests during the most hours hot of the day; at night, it fed on the little vegetation found in the desert.

Camel arabigo (Camelus dromedarius)

Also called dromedary , this is of a mammal in its species, whose main characteristic is a hump that is located on its back.To resist the hot sands of the desert, the camel needs to adapt its body, so it has long-lasting eyelashes to prevent sand from entering in his eyes, and calloused knees and ankles that isolate the high temperatures.

However, the most notable feature of this camel is the hump, where it is capable of producing water with the fat it accumulates.In this way, the animal remains hydrated no matter how far the next source of water is.

Yellow scorpion (Leiurus quinquestriatus)

Also called Palestinian, it has a yellowish hue in all its body, with a tail that ends in black on many occasions.Precisely that characteristic allows it to remain hidden from its possible predators.

When this does not work, the scorpion has a poison that, although not usually mortal, if it is extremely painful for those who are victims of an attack.

Zorro fenec (Vulpes zerda)

This is a small mammal of the canine family, which inhabits this desert.Its fur, between blond and reddish, allows you to easily camouflage with the sand dunes.One of its may Distinctive prayers are the long ears , which allow you to regulate your temperature to cool the body when the heat is very intense.It is mostly nocturnal, at which time it leaves your burrow to hunt.You can survive a long time without water, waiting to find an oasis.

Animals that live in the desert of Mexico

The desert of Mexico occupies about 40% of the total area of ​​the country. It is not just one, but four deserts in different parts of the country: San Luis de Potosi, Baja California, Sonora and Chihuahua.Some of these deserts are not only part of Mexico, but also of the United States.

In each of them inhabit different species of desert animals and plants, such as They are:

Comet or fast fox (Vulpes velox)

From the size of a homemade cat, the fast fox not only feeds on other animals, but also fruits and herbs.the desert builds burrows in the sand, where it stays cool during the day, hunting at night .

Berrendo or American antilope (Antilocapra americana)

It is not only found in Mexico, but also in some areas of the United States and Canada.It is a mammal similar to the antilope, but unique in its kind, which moves in droves, over all or during more times Warm.Adapted to the hostile environment of the deserts, it feeds on the scarce herbs found, and even cactus, so characteristic of dry and sandy ecosystems.

Tiger salamander (Ambystoma tigrinum)

He lives on land and only approaches aquatic environments at the time of reproduction.The larvae are very resistant, so they are able to support their development in adverse natural conditions, such as those present in deserts It feeds mostly on small worms and insects.

Animals that live in the desert of Chile

In Chile there are several deserts, of which the most popular is that of Atacama, located in the north of the country, and which is the masarido of the world .The area It is rich in metallic, non-metallic resources and magnesium salt, important sources of the Chilean economy.One of its peculiarities is the phenomenon of the florid desert, which consists in the growth of an unusual amount of flowers when rainfall in the area exceeds the annual average.

Chile also includes sections of deserts that share with bordering countries, such as the Pacific desert and the South American desert.Now, these are some of the animals that abound in the desert and that you can find among its dunes:

Vicuna (Vicugna vicugna)

It is a mammal of the family of camels , beige fur and cream, so it is easily confused with desert areas.Its legs are padded, allowing or that they move without much difficulty on very hot or rocky soils; In addition, their thick and dense fur protects them from the inclemency of the temperature, blocking the wind, the waste that it brings, and protecting the vicuna from the cold when the temperature drops at night.

Guanaco (Lama guanicoe)

It is a mammal also of the family of camels, of delicate texture.It feeds on small grasses and bushes.It lives in flocks, where the male is responsible for protecting to the young and the female.Its fur is between reddish and sandy, beneficial for an animal that lives between dunes and rocks.

Vizcacha of the mountains (Lagidium viscacia)

It is a rodent physically similar to the hare, which can be found not only in Chile, but also in Peru and Argentina.The fur is thick, which protects it from the desert wind and keeps it warm at night.It takes refuge among the rocks, and feeds on small grasses.

Animals that live in the desert of Antarctica

Surely you are wondering, a desert, in the Antarctic? The truth is that the word "desert" does not imply only drylands where heat reigns, but any inhospitable space where life, called fauna or flora, is scarce due to adverse conditions .Taking this into account, What a desolate place, at least in appearance, than the ice continent?

Even so, plants and animals have managed to develop enough defenses for this to be their home.What animals are in the Antarctic desert? Some of them are:

Seal (Phocidae)

Mammal mostly marine, but also able to survive on land.More than hair, the seals are covered with a thick layer of skin, whose main function is to withstand low temperatures.They feed on penguins, fish and other marine animals.

Penguin (Spheniscidae)

Although it is a bird, the penguin does not fly, so that their life develops on land and, above all, in the water.To do this, their wings have adapted perfectly to the ocean , where they function as fins capable of propelling them very quickly.It is also conditioned to withstand the cold weather, so under the superficial layer of feathers, they have a fat that keeps them warm.

Antarctic petrel (Thalassoica antarctica)

Lead colored bird with white breast, is distributed in certain regions of the Antarctic continent.Its body is story adapted to withstand the cold, and feeds on small marine animals that hunt in the icy waters, such as krill and other crustaceans.

Marine elephant (Mirounga)

Mammal presenting a marked dimorphism between males and females, as males weigh and measure twice as much as their female counterparts.They feed on other marine animals, and the considerable layer of fat that forms the elephant's body protects them against the gelid water of the Antarctica.

Antarctic sea lion (Arctophoca gazella)

Mammal of the same seal family, capable of living both on land and in the ocean.It feeds on krill, fish and Crustaceans.As with his relatives, the main adaptation of his body to the habitat is the thick layer of skin and fat that insulates the cold.
